Of course you can't see it. 'Stutter' manifests itself as lower perceived frame rate, and if that perceived frame rate is still over your threshold for smoothness, you'll view it as smooth.

If I had you play a game at 50FPS and told you that it was running at 60FPS, would you be able to notice? Would you call me out on it? Would anything jump out at you? Of course not, but that doesn't change the fact 60FPS is better and smoother than 50FPS. The same is true when it comes to the distribution of frames in a more even vs. less even manner. Just because you can't "see" it doesn't mean that uneven frame distribution doesn't have a detrimental effect on gameplay.

One of the best ways I have seen to show the impact of microstutter is to have two machines side by side where one of them is doing it and the other is not. It becomes immediately apparent something is wrong on the stuttering machine despite its decent frame rate. Your eyes notice the stutter comparatively. Once you have seen that you have trained your brain to recognise it.

But microstutter comes in different magnitudes. A 2ms swing I doubt anyone could notice. 16ms effectively halves the frame rate on a 60hz monitor (30fps) and beyond that the appearance is below 30fps so almost everyone notices 20ms and beyond.

You needs fraps. In fraps there is an option for capturing frame times. Tick it. Use F11 (or whatever key you set) to capture a a trace. It will produce a .csv file into the benchmark folder, load it into excel/OO calc etc and then create one additional column taking the difference of the frame times. (just =A2-A1 all the way down). Then graph the frames on x and frame times on y and you'll get a chart just like TechReport.

The ideal 60hz picture is one with a straight line at 16.6ms. If its consistently higher than that, say 33.3 then its 30fps (1000/frametime = fps) and its just poor frames per second causing the poor feeling of motion. If however what is happening is its got a consistent back and forth spiking around 16.6ms then that is microstutter and I am calling the magnitude the difference of the top and the bottom. So an oscillation from 10 to 22ms is 12ms microstutter. If you see big jumps from a standard level then those are just momentary drops of fps, most people just call that a stutter or a judder.

So the 3 types of performance problem we can look for in frame time graphs are:
1) Microstutter - oscillations around some average frame time that keeps going above and below that average over and over.
2) Stutter - A big swing (up or down) for a moment that causes a jump in the game play.
3) Poor frame time - an average frame time that is not producing a good fps. Ideally it should read 16.6ms (1000/60), for 30 fps (1000/30) = 33.3ms.

If you want to get fancy I am also interested in the amount of variance in the variance. That is take the difference of the frame times to each other If you graph that you will get a graph that oscillates around the 0 point, goes positive and negative and it shows the amount of change. What I originally thought would happen when I took the deriative of frame times was that if I abs() the values I would get a consistent picture showing the amount of microstutter as a straight graph as well as seeing the judders. But I dont see that, I actually see just as much variance in the variance for all the traces I have.
